New Issue: Morgan Stanley prices $1.98 million leveraged buffered notes linked to MSCI EAFE
By Marisa Wong
Morgantown, W.Va., June 1 – Morgan Stanley Finance LLC priced $1.98 million of 0% leveraged buffered notes due May 7, 2019 linked to the MSCI EAFE index, according to a 424B2 fil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.
The notes are guaranteed by Morgan Stanley.
The payout at maturity will be par plus 150% of any index gain, up to a maximum settlement amount of $1,229.80 for each $1,000 principal amount of notes.
Investors will receive par if the index falls by up to 12.5% and will lose 1.1429% for each 1% index decline beyond 12.5%.
Morgan Stanley is the agent.
